Biography

Catharina Mischler is the daughter of Jacob Ulrich Mischler and Anna Dodereas (aka Dorothea) Mueller. On April 22, 1754, Catharina married Casper Diefenbach

Catherine was the 3rd wife of Casper Diefenbach in 1754 marriage. [1]
